Analysis
In 2024, barley — gross production value in Ecuador stood at 4,726 1000 SLC.
The figure is up 22.8% on the previous year and down 27.8% over ten years.
Over the whole period, barley — gross production value in Ecuador peaked at 58,730 1000 SLC in 1963 and was at its lowest, 3,848 1000 SLC, in 2023.
That places Ecuador 79th out of 85 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 39,758 1000 SLC | 31,778 1000 SLC | 58,730 1000 SLC | 9 |
| 1970s | 25,585 1000 SLC | 9,358 1000 SLC | 36,085 1000 SLC | 10 |
| 1980s | 16,364 1000 SLC | 10,999 1000 SLC | 25,267 1000 SLC | 10 |
| 1990s | 16,555 1000 SLC | 14,311 1000 SLC | 20,285 1000 SLC | 10 |
| 2000s | 10,299 1000 SLC | 8,110 1000 SLC | 11,907 1000 SLC | 10 |
| 2010s | 7,454 1000 SLC | 4,032 1000 SLC | 11,479 1000 SLC | 10 |
| 2020s | 5,323 1000 SLC | 3,848 1000 SLC | 6,631 1000 SLC | 5 |

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
